The History of the Company

The Chase Mortgage Company is one which is considered as being a leading global financial services firm with assets of over .4 trillion, and they operate in more than 50 countries worldwide and have more than 170,000 employees in total. They serve millions of U.S. consumers, as well as many of the worlds most prominent corporate, institutional and governmental clients.

They are one of the leaders in the world when it comes to areas such as investment banking, financial services for customers and financial transaction processing. Located in New York City, the Chase Mortgage Company has been around for over a decade now, and today their retail financial services and commercial banking headquarters are located in Chicago.

There have been several key incidents which have led up to the overall foundation of the Chase Mortgage Company, including: in 1991, the Chemical Banking Corporation combined with Manufacturers Hanover Corporation, keeping the name Chemical Banking Corporation, which was then known as being the second-largest banking institution in the United States; in 1995, the First Chicago Corporation merged with the National Bank of Detroits parent NBD Bancorp, resulting in the formation of First Chicago NBD, the largest banking company at that time which was based in the Midwest.

Then, in 1996, Chase Manhattan Corporation merged with the Chemical Banking Corporation, creating what was then considered as being the largest overall bank holding company in all the United States; in 1998, Banc One Corporation merged with First Chicago NBD, taking the name Bank One Corporation, and ended up becoming the fourth-largest bank in the United States and the worlds largest Visa credit card issuer.
